Core Purpose

The Central Government declares the acquisition and absolute vesting of specified land in the Central Government for a Special Railway Project, in exercise of powers under sub-sections (1) and (2) of Section 20E of the Railways Act, 1989.

Detailed Summary

This notification, S.O. 1925(E) issued by the Ministry of Railways (North Central Railway) on April 9, 2026, declares the acquisition and absolute vesting of specified lands in the Central Government. This action is taken under sub-sections (1) and (2) of Section 20E of the Railways Act, 1989 (24 of 1989), read with the Railways (Amendment) ACT, 2008 (No. 11 of 2008). The land is being acquired for a Special Railway Project: "Construction of 02-lane road over bridge in lieu of level crossing No.540 at Km 1422/16-18 in Agra-Palwal Section in Agra Division of North Central Railway" located in District Mathura, Uttar Pradesh. This follows a previous notification, S.O. 4917(E) dated October 13, 2025, which declared the intention to acquire the land under sub-section (1) of section 20A of the said Act. Public notice of the intention was published in local newspapers on November 9, 2025, including the "TIMES OF INDIA" (English). Two objections were received regarding Semari village, and the Competent Authority passed orders accordingly, subsequently submitting its report to the Central Government. The schedule annexed to this notification details the land to be acquired, totaling 1.0382 Hectares of private agricultural land across plots 685(mi), 693(mi), 711/1(mi), 711/2(mi), and 711/3(mi) in Semari village, Tehsil Chhata, along with the names of associated landowners. Upon publication of this notification, the land vests absolutely in the Central Government free from all encumbrances.

No. E- NCR-HQ0CENG(MIC)/19/2024-O/oDY.CE/Br./L/AGC (Computer No. 126916)] MINISTRY OF RAILWAYS [North Central Railway (Bridge Line Unit)] NOTIFICATION Prayagraj, the 9th April, 2026 S.O. 1925(E). - Whereas, by the notification of the Government of India in the Ministry of Railways (North Central Railway), number S.O. 4917(E) Dated 13-10-2025 published in the Gazette of India, Extraordinary, Part II, Section 3, Sub-Section (ii), 4766 dated the 29-10-2025 and issued under the sub-section (1) of section 20A of the Railways Act, 1989 (24 of 1989) and the Railways (Amendment) ACT, 2008 (No. 11 of 2008) (hereinafter referred to as ths said Act), the Central Government declared its intention to acquire the land specified in the schedule annexed to the said notification for execution, maintenance management and operation of a Special Railway Project namely, Construction of 02-lane road over bridge in lieu of level crossing No.540 at Km 1422/16-18 in Agra-Palwal Section in Agra Division of North Central Railway” in District Mathura in the state of Uttar Pradesh. And whereas, the substance of the said notification has been published in the daily local newspapers namely, “AMAR UJALA" (Hindi), dated the 09-11-2025, “HINDUSTAN” (Hindi), dated the 09-11-2025, and “TIMES OF INDIA" (English), dated the 09-11-2025 under the sub-section (4) of section 20A of the said Act; and whereas, in Semari village two objections were received and competent Authority have passed the orders accordingly; Any whereas, in pursuance of sub-section (1) of section 20E of the said Act, the competent Authority has submitted its report to the Central Government. Now therefore, upon receipt of the report of the Competent Authority and in exercise of the powers conferred by sub-section (1) of Section 20E of the said Act, the Central Government hereby declares that the lands specified in the schedule annexed here to shall be acquired for the aforesaid purpose. And further, in pursuance of sub-section (2) of Section 20E of the said Act, the Central Government hereby declares that on publication of this notification in the official Gazette, the land specified in the schedule annexed here to shall vest absolutely in the Central Government free from all encumbrances.
